April 20, 200619 yr Mercedes Announces Pricing on 2007 SL550 and GL450 Date posted: 04-19-2006 MONTVALE, N.J. — The 2007 Mercedes-Benz SL550 coupe/roadster starts at $95,575, including a $775 destination charge, while the 2007 Mercedes-Benz GL450 SUV has a base price of $55,675, including destination, the company said. The new SL550 comes equipped with a four-valve-per-cylinder V8 that produces 382 horsepower and 391 pound-feet of torque, a power increase of more than 26 percent over the outgoing SL500. In the U.S., the SL550 features the company's hands-free communication as standard equipment, as well as standard Sirius satellite radio. The seven-seat GL450 will be sold in the U.S. with a 4.6-liter V8 that makes 335 horsepower and 339 pound-feet of torque. It is equipped with a seven-speed automatic transmission and full-time four-wheel drive. Mercedes also announced a slight price increase for the 2006 SLR McLaren coupe, to $452,750 from $452,500. The SLR McLaren price includes a $2,750 destination charge for container shipment, the company said.
